What is a Social Media Strategy, and Why Do You Need One?
A social media strategy outlines your goals, target audience, content plan, and metrics for success on social media platforms. Having a clear strategy helps you stay focused, ensures consistency across all your social media channels, and ultimately drives more engagement and conversions. Here's a step-by-step guide to creating a social media strategy using our free template:- Define Your Goals: What do you want to achieve on social media? Do you want to increase brand awareness, drive website traffic, or generate leads? Make sure your goals are spec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ART).
- Choose Your Social Media Platforms: Which social media platforms does your target audience use most? Focus on 2-3 platforms to start, and make sure you're posting content that's optimized for each platform.
- Develop a Content Plan: What type of content will you post, and how often will you post it? Create a content calendar to ensure consistency and efficiency.
- Create Engaging Content: What type of content resonates with your audience? Use a mix of promotional, educational, and entertaining content to keep your audience engaged.
Best Practices and Pro Tips
Here are some additional best practices and pro tips to keep in mind: Post consistently: Aim to post at least 3-5 times per week on each platform.
Use high-quality visuals: Use high-quality images, videos, and graphics to make your content stand out.
Engage with your audience: Respond to comments and messages promptly to build relationships with your audience.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
Don't make these common mistakes when creating your social media strategy: Not having a clear goal: Without a clear goal, you'll struggle to measure success and adjust your strategy.
Not understanding your audience: Failing to understand your audience's needs and interests will lead to irrelevant content and low engagement.
Not tracking metrics: Failing to track metrics such as engagement, website traffic, and conversions will make it difficult to adjust your strategy and optimize results.
